The surname Ramachandrareddy is mainly found among communities in the Indian states of Andhra Pradesh and Telangana, where the Reddy caste is a well-known agricultural group. The religion associated with RAMACHANDRAREDDY surname is hinduism. The community associated with this surname is reddy. The MotherTounge associated with this surname is telugu.
Within the Reddy community, families with this surname often belong to subgroups identified by their ancestral villages or regional ties. These subgroups historically held important positions in local government and landowning. The surname combines the given name Ramachandra with the Reddy caste name, a common way to show family history and community identity.

The surname appears in these variations: Ramachandra Reddy, Ramachandrareddi, and Ramchandrareddy.
